As a web designer, creating a responsive one-page HTML template is a crucial skill to have in your arsenal. With the increasing use of mobile devices and tablets, having a website that adapts to different screen sizes and devices is no longer a luxury, but a necessity. In this article, we will explore the importance of responsive design, the benefits of one-page templates, and provide a step-by-step guide on how to create a responsive one-page HTML template.
What is Responsive Design?
Responsive design is an approach to web design that ensures a website's layout, content, and visual elements adapt to different screen sizes, devices, and orientations. This means that whether a user accesses your website on a desktop computer, tablet, or smartphone, the website will automatically adjust its layout to provide an optimal viewing experience.
Benefits of Responsive Design
- Improved user experience: Responsive design ensures that users can easily navigate and access content on your website, regardless of the device they use.
- Increased conversions: By providing an optimal viewing experience, responsive design can increase conversions, such as sales, leads, and sign-ups.
- Better search engine optimization (SEO): Google recommends responsive design as the best approach for mobile-friendliness, which can improve your website's search engine rankings.
What is a One-Page Template?
A one-page template is a website design that consists of a single page, where all the content is presented in a linear and continuous manner. One-page templates are ideal for websites that require a simple and straightforward presentation of content, such as portfolios, landing pages, and small business websites.
Benefits of One-Page Templates
- Simplified navigation: One-page templates eliminate the need for complex navigation menus, making it easier for users to find what they're looking for.
- Increased engagement: By presenting all the content on a single page, one-page templates can increase user engagement and encourage users to scroll and explore the content.
- Faster loading times: One-page templates typically require less code and fewer resources, resulting in faster loading times and improved performance.
Creating a Responsive One-Page HTML Template
To create a responsive one-page HTML template, follow these steps:
Step 1: Plan Your Template
- Define the purpose and content of your template.
- Sketch a wireframe of your template's layout.
- Identify the key elements and sections of your template.
Step 2: Write the HTML Structure
- Start with a basic HTML structure, including the
<!DOCTYPE>
,<html>
,<head>
, and<body>
tags. - Create a container element, such as a
<div>
, to wrap the entire template. - Add a header, navigation, and footer sections.
Step 3: Add CSS Styles
- Use a CSS reset to normalize browser styles.
- Define a typography system, including font sizes, line heights, and font families.
- Create a color scheme and apply it to your template.
Step 4: Make it Responsive
- Use media queries to define different breakpoints for different devices and screen sizes.
- Use flexible units, such as percentages and ems, to make your template adaptable to different screen sizes.
- Use CSS grid or flexbox to create a flexible and responsive layout.
Step 5: Add Interactivity
- Use JavaScript to add interactivity to your template, such as scrolling effects, animations, and hover states.
- Use a library or framework, such as jQuery or React, to simplify your code and improve performance.
Best Practices for Responsive One-Page Templates
To ensure that your responsive one-page template is effective and user-friendly, follow these best practices:
- Keep it simple: Avoid clutter and keep your template's design simple and straightforward.
- Use clear typography: Use clear and readable typography to ensure that your content is easily readable.
- Make it interactive: Use JavaScript and CSS to add interactivity to your template and engage users.
- Test and iterate: Test your template on different devices and screen sizes, and iterate on your design to ensure that it is effective.
Tools and Resources for Responsive One-Page Templates
To help you create a responsive one-page template, here are some tools and resources:
- HTML and CSS frameworks, such as Bootstrap and Foundation.
- CSS preprocessors, such as Sass and Less.
- JavaScript libraries, such as jQuery and React.
- Design and prototyping tools, such as Sketch and Figma.
Conclusion
Creating a responsive one-page HTML template requires a combination of planning, coding, and testing. By following the steps and best practices outlined in this article, you can create a template that is both effective and user-friendly. Remember to keep it simple, use clear typography, make it interactive, and test and iterate on your design.
We hope this article has provided you with the knowledge and inspiration to create a responsive one-page HTML template that meets your needs. If you have any questions or comments, please feel free to share them below.
What is the purpose of a responsive one-page template?
+A responsive one-page template is designed to provide a simple and straightforward presentation of content, ideal for websites that require a single page, such as portfolios, landing pages, and small business websites.
How do I make my one-page template responsive?
+To make your one-page template responsive, use media queries to define different breakpoints for different devices and screen sizes, and use flexible units, such as percentages and ems, to make your template adaptable to different screen sizes.
What tools and resources can I use to create a responsive one-page template?
+Some popular tools and resources for creating a responsive one-page template include HTML and CSS frameworks, such as Bootstrap and Foundation, CSS preprocessors, such as Sass and Less, and design and prototyping tools, such as Sketch and Figma.